Abstract

A liquid dispenser contains, in a closed housing, a liquid container with a filling opening, which is arranged on its upper face, for the liquid. In the housing, the liquid container is oriented opposite a pump. The pump, together with an operating element, is arranged on a slide which can be moved to a release position in which the pump is disengaged from the container. The slide can be moved into an engagement position in which the pump is arranged completely within the liquid container. The front wall of the housing can be folded open in the forward direction together with the upper face, in order to permit access to the liquid container.

Claims (14)

  1. A liquid dispenser comprising
    a housing,
    a receiving space embodied in the housing for a container (22), which contains the liquid,
    a pump (41) for sucking the liquid out of the container (22) and for dispensing the liquid by means of a dispensing nozzle (9),
    as well as comprising
    an operating element (6) for the pump (41), which can be operated from outside of the housing for dispensing a portion of the liquid, characterized in that, if applicable, the pump (41) is arranged together with the operating element (6) at a slide (19), which encompasses an engaged position, in which the pump (41) engages with the container (22), and a release position, in which the container (22) is free.
  2. The liquid dispenser according to claim 1, where the operating element (6) is arranged at the upper side of the housing and can be operated from there.
  3. The liquid dispenser according to claim 1 or 2, where the dispensing nozzle (9) is arranged at the operating element (6).
  4. The liquid dispenser according to one of the preceding claims, where the pump (41) is arranged and embodied in such a manner that it sucks the liquid out of a filler opening (24) of the container (22) at the upper side thereof.
  5. The liquid dispenser according to claim 4, where the pump (41) engages at least partially with the filler opening (24) of the liquid container (22).
  6. The liquid dispenser according to one of the preceding claims, where, in the engaged position, the pump (41) is completely arranged within the container (22).
  7. The liquid dispenser according to one of the preceding claims, where the slide (19) is guided at the rear wall (40) of the housing.
  8. The liquid dispenser according to one of the preceding claims, where the housing encompasses a centering means for the container (22).
  9. The liquid dispenser according to one of claims 6 to 8, where the container (22) can be fixed on the slide (19) in the engagement position thereof.
  10. The liquid dispenser according to claim 9, where the fixation of the container (22) on the slide (19) is carried out by gripping a neck (23), which surrounds the filler opening (24) of the container (22).
  11. The liquid dispenser according to one of the preceding claims, where the housing encompasses a folding front wall (4), which can preferably be pivoted about a horizontal axis of rotation in the area of the bottom edge thereof.
  12. The liquid dispenser according to one of the preceding claims, where the operating element (6) for the pump (41) is mounted in the rear area of the housing and projects forward freely.
  13. The liquid dispenser according to one of the preceding claims, where the front end of the operating element (6) is arranged in front of the front wall (4) of the housing, in particular also the dispensing nozzle (9).
  14. The liquid dispenser according to one of the preceding claims, where the operating element (6) is embodied so as to be capable of being pivoted about a horizontal axis.
